Overview of Role: Our client in the North East area is looking for an Accounts Payable/ Accounts Receivable Assistant to join their team on a permanent basis. To provide back-up cover and support to the AR & AP teams on a daily/ weekly/ monthly basis as required and to provide relief cover for reception daily breaks and annual leave. Responsibilities: Reception. To provide back up and support for reception for annual leave periods and daily break times. Greet and welcome visitors, customers and suppliers. Ensure the visitor’s record book is completed and advise relevant staff member of visitor’s arrival. Answer all incoming calls in a timely manner and redirect calls as appropriate. Ensure the reception area is clean, presentable and portrays a business like image at all times. Liaise with couriers/ delivery personnel for all incoming and outgoing packages ensuring that correct process is followed for the security of valuable items. Book couriers/ taxis/ flights/ accommodation as requested and ensure correct procedure/ process is followed. Process incoming and outgoing mail and ensure correct procedure/ process is followed. Account Receivable/ Accounts Payable. Process Master data requests for the opening of new customer and supplier accounts as required. Process any Master Data updates required/ requested for existing customer and supplier accounts. Cross train with other team members to ensure full knowledge across group ledgers on all business critical tasks. Provide holiday support cover across the team as and when required for all aspects of accounts receivable and credit control. Provide holiday support cover across the team as and when required for all aspects of accounts payable. Responsibility for specific tasks across the AR & AP teams. Any other ad hoc duties as outlined/ requested by your manager. Required/ Desirable Qualifications and Experience: Accounting Technician Student or Part Qualified Accountant a distinct advantage. Leaving certificate or equivalent qualification. Minimum one years’ experience working in a busy office environment. Experience of working within a reception role/ environment a distinct advantage. Commitment to a high level of customer care. Excellent Attention to detail. Excellent verbal and communication skills and telephone manner. Excellent working knowledge of Excel. Ability to work to a high standard and proficiency in multi-tasking. A basic understanding of accounts receivable and accounts payable.
